Cinema Arts Program: Shared Secrets

Saturday, Aug 9 2:00p
at Exploratorium, San Francisco, CA
Age Suitability: None Specified
Tags: museum

Cinema Arts Program: Shared Secrets McBean Theater, 2:00 p.m. Lost and Found (2006, 16 min.), by independent San Francisco filmmaker Natalija Vekic, tells the story of an imaginative twelve-year old girl named Lolly who fills a void in her life by making up stories about found objects. Over the course of a day, Lolly unravels the mystery of a lost letter. Through the small gesture of returning the letter to its owner, two strangers reveal a nurturing empathy as they share a moment of grief. Winner of the 2006 San Francisco International Film Festival's Golden Gate Award.
